Output ecf386c6f76eed99353cc6240b27a5c8353561487d2ef4920c5f84010d2547e9:0

value
64020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ef6d18629aa38eb90810e6889157aaad342f7cb3 OP_EQUALVERIFY OP_CHECKSIG
address
1NpyBvHKrbQgcRpeDqfaTLRhHBNYGX3Zkm
transaction
ecf386c6f76eed99353cc6240b27a5c8353561487d2ef4920c5f84010d2547e9
spent
true